What companies run services between Toronto Airport (YYZ), Canada and Swiss Alps, Canton Ticino, Switzerland?

There is no direct connection from Toronto Airport (YYZ) to Swiss Alps. However, you can fly to Zurich Airport (ZRH), walk to Zürich Flughafen, take the train to Zürich HB, take the train to Airolo, walk to Airolo, Stazione, then take the line 110 bus to Gotthard Passhöhe. Alternatively, you can fly to Basel (BSL), walk to Basel EuroAirport, Ankunft, take the line 50 bus to Basel, Bahnhof SBB, walk to Basel SBB, take the train to Airolo, walk to Airolo, Stazione, then take the line 110 bus to Gotthard Passhöhe.
